AMD Ryzen 5 5600H vs Intel Core i7 6820HQ

We compared two laptop CPUs: AMD Ryzen 5 5600H with 6 cores 3.3GHz and Intel Core i7 6820HQ with 4 cores 2.7GHz . You will find out which processor performs better in benchmark tests, key specifications, power consumption and more.

Main Differences

AMD Ryzen 5 5600H 's Advantages
Released 5 years and 4 months late
Higher specification of memory (LPDDR4-4266 vs DDR4-2133)
Larger memory bandwidth (51.2GB/s vs 34.1GB/s)
Higher base frequency (3.3GHz vs 2.7GHz)
Larger L3 cache size (16MB vs 8MB)
Lower TDP (35W vs 45W)
